Transaction 043960225fed10075737677614f7d8e31dc36ec86805d547c482185c9ef15431
1 Input
1 Output
-
043960225fed10075737677614f7d8e31dc36ec86805d547c482185c9ef15431:0
- value
- 122745
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f15d07d4a898c04ae4e68df61a141d81cd8a1578 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P1DJ7NChWdkWsRi1mEjE3aJQ1Fwod2zSG